Responsibilities: 

Works closely and collaboratively with the Assistant Directors and VP of the company to determine and delegate short-term and long-term clinical improvement initiatives. Provides oversight of BTs including hiring, managing, training and mentoring. While managing scheduling, supervision, and evaluation of designated team members. Provides mentoring, training, and competency assessments as necessary. Work closely with service coordinators and school district personnel to ensure effective and ongoing communication is delivered.  Collaborates with Assistant Directors in the development and implementation of internal trainings for continuing education, compliance, and professional growth to all employees Monday-Friday (flexible daytime hours) - 35 hours weekly Provide direct and/or indirect services to students and families, conduct evaluations, attend CSE meetings, and/or provide coverage for staff absences as deemed necessary by their supervisors Participate in collaborative team meetings clinical providers, clinicians, and paraprofessionals Travel required throughout Nassau Provide direct and/or indirect services to students and families, conduct evaluations, attend CSE meetings, and/or provide coverage for staff absences as deemed necessary by their supervisors and more!

And this background: 

Minimum of a master’s degree in one of the following: Behavior Analysis, Special Education, Psychology, Educational/Health/Human Services  BCBA/ LBA preferred.  Minimum of (1) year experience working in a setting focusing on supporting children and adolescents with autism and other behavioral disorders.  Experience with electronic data collection services.   Bilingual is a plus.
